    As an environmental epidemiologist, I lead an interdisciplinary program of research focused on understanding the long-term health risks for cardiovascular, respiratory and metabolic diseases resulting from the interplay between early-life environmental exposures, susceptibility factors, and biological mechanisms. I co-direct the Maternal And Developmental Risks from Environmental and Social Stressors (MADRES) Center located in the Environmental Health Division. Within the Center, my work addresses the interplay between environmental health inequities, social stressors, and epigenetic mechanisms underlying child health outcomes. I take multigenerational approach to examine whether pre- and postpartum environmental exposures such as air pollution, tobacco smoke, heavy metals and chemical exposures, coupled with exposures to psychosocial and built environment stressors, affect birth outcomes, perturbed infant growth trajectories and increased childhood obesity risk. Additional work has investigated how environmental exposures alter epigenetic profiles in pregnancy and in newborns and young children, and what roles those changes play in responding to environmental exposures and driving disease risk, particularly in vulnerable populations. I has conducted both epigenome-wide and targeted epigenomic investigations, as well as multi-generational investigations, to better understand the roles of DNA methylation and miRNA underlying environment health effects.
